What this failure is
GPU Fallen Off the Bus (Xid 79) is a Hardware failure seen during ML training runs. A GPU drops off the PCIe bus (Xid 79) and disappears from the system. A critical hardware/connectivity fault that ends training on that node until the GPU is recovered. Common tags: Xid 79, Fallen Off Bus, Pcie, Hardware.

Why it happens (the mechanism)
PCIe link lost (power instability, thermal, or physical seating). Failing GPU hardware. Riser/connector fault. What you'll observe
- A GPU vanishes from nvidia-smi mid-run
- Training crashes with the GPU unavailable
- Xid 79 in the kernel log
Common symptoms and what they mean
| Symptom | Why it happens |
|---|---|
| Xid 79: GPU has fallen off the bus | PCIe link lost (power instability, thermal, or physical seating) |
| nvidia-smi: GPU is lost / not listed | Failing GPU hardware |
| ERR! or missing entry for the GPU | Riser/connector fault |
Which systems are affected
- Any PCIe-attached GPU
- Nodes with marginal power/thermal or seating
- Dense multi-GPU servers

Xid 79 in context
Xid 79 is one of a small set of codes the NVIDIA driver uses to report GPU faults, and the number is most of the diagnosis: it tells you whether you are looking at your own code, the driver, or a board that needs replacing.
